## Changelog — Ledgerline worker 3.1: blue-green defaults changed

Note for the contractor onboarding this week. Blue-green deploys are now the default for the billing worker; the old in-place rollout path is removed. Traffic shifts to green only after the invoice-drain check passes, and rollback is automatic on error-rate breach. Bake time went from 5 to 15 minutes after the Octavel incident. Don't override without sign-off. Current deploy defaults follow below.

deployment values, bahof-badug:
[rusix]
team = zorok
access_code = ac_641cbe
owner = ulair.tamius
host = rusix.torvasoft.local
port = 5672
peer = ulaix.sivrelworks.internal
salt = 1df570ed
pin = 6327

TURN-208: Gatevale turnstile counters at the Merrow Field pilot double-count when a rotation reverses mid-cycle. Attendance totals drift roughly 2% high per event. The debounce window fix is implemented, reviewed by Ilsa, and soak-tested across two simulated match days without drift. Ready for your cut; the candidate build is identified below.

trace token, tagag-tafog: htk6_5ed18c

Subject: Bounce processor cut-over — wrapped up

Hey,

Quick summary for the release notes: we cut the Mailwright bounce processor over to the new parsing pipeline last night. Old queue drained by 02:10, new consumer picked up cleanly, and suppression updates are flowing again. One hiccup with a stuck DLQ message, resolved manually. Nothing left blocking sign-off on your end. For the record, here's the config the new pipeline is running with.

service settings:
PRAIX_LOG_LEVEL=error
PRAIX_METRICS_HOST=metrics.praix.qorvelcorp.corp
PRAIX_POOL_SIZE=16